Carillion Joint Venture awarded £61 million contract for Phase 1 of Dubai Trade Centre development  

 

Dubai World Trade Centre has awarded Al Futtaim Carillion the main contract to deliver the first phase of the Dubai Trade Centre District (DTCD), a 146,000 square metre development between the current Dubai International Convention and Exhibition Centre and Emirates Towers in the heart of the city's Central Business District.  The contract, which is worth approximately £61 million and includes an eight storey office building and a 588-room business and tourism hotel, will begin in April 2014 and is scheduled for completion in Q3 2015.

 

The DTCD development will be designed to best-in-class quality standards and Phase 1 will include international Grade A quality offices, which has achieved LEED® Gold precertification from the US Green Building Council - the industry benchmark for green building performance covering design, construction, operations and maintenance.  The technology solutions and infrastructure being planned are aligned with the Dubai Government's Smart City strategic agenda, which was launched by Vice-President and Prime Minister of the UAE and Ruler of Dubai, His Highness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um.

 

"The Dubai World Trade Centre has always been a core enabler of business tourism for Dubai. The District development justly complements this current proposition, offering a premium destination that will serve as a networking and commercial hub for the international business community," said Helal Saeed Almarri, Director General, Department of Tourism and Commerce Marketing and CEO, Dubai World Trade Centre.

 

Commenting on the award, the UK Consul General to Dubai, Edward Hobart said:  "The news that Dubai World Trade Centre has selected Al Futtaim Carillion to build the first phase of this major development in Dubai is wonderful, especially as it comes during the visit to Dubai of the UK Minister for Trade and Investment, Lord Livingston.  This is yet another example of British expertise playing its role in the impressive growth and development of Dubai's infrastructure." 

 

Carillion Chief Executive, Richard Howson, also welcomed the award, citing the Emirate as a core market for Carillion: "We are delighted to have been selected for the first phase of this major development in Dubai, where we continue to see more opportunities coming to market for which our capabilities and reputation for delivering to high standards of quality, safety and reliability are important to customers.  We look forward to working with Dubai World Trade Centre to deliver this important development."     

 

Notes to Editors - Carillion

Carillion is a leading integrated support services company with a substantial portfolio of Public Private Partnership projects and extensive construction capabilities.  The Group had annual revenue in 2013 of some £4.1 billion, employs around 40,000 people and operates across the UK, in the Middle East and Canada. 

 

The Group has four business segments.

 

Support services - this includes facilities management, facilities services, energy services, utility services, road maintenance, rail services and consultancy services.

 

Public Private Partnership (PPP) projects - this includes investing activities in PPP projects for Government buildings and infrastructure, mainly in the Defence, Health, Education, Transport and Secure accommodation sectors.

 

Middle East construction services - this includes building and civil engineering activities in the Middle East.

 

Construction services (excluding the Middle East) - this includes building, civil engineering and developments activities in the UK and construction activities in Canada.

Dubai World Trade Centre (DWTC)

With a vision to make Dubai the world's leading destination for all major exhibitions, conferences and events, DWTC has evolved from being the forerunner of the fast growing exhibitions industry into a multi-dimensional business catalyst, focusing on Venues, Events and Real Estate Management. Complementary to the primary service offerings are a range of value added services from media/advertising, engineering and technical consultation and wedding planning, security services and an award winning hospitality portfolio.
